Ken Crouch was a 2016 Democratic candidate for District 45 of the Montana House of Representatives.

Crouch was a Democratic candidate for District 55 in the Montana House of Representatives in the November 2, 2010, state legislative elections.

Elections

2016

See also: Montana House of Representatives elections, 2016

Elections for the Montana House of Representatives took place in 2016. The primary election was held on June 7, 2016, and the general election was held on November 8, 2016. The candidate filing deadline was March 14, 2016.

Incumbent Daniel Zolnikov defeated Ken Crouch in the Montana House of Representatives District 45 general election.[1][2]

Montana House of Representatives, District 45 General Election, 2016
Party Candidate Vote % Votes
     Republican Green check mark transparent.png Daniel Zolnikov Incumbent 69.46% 3,305
     Democratic Ken Crouch 30.54% 1,453
Total Votes 4,758
Source: Montana Secretary of State


Ken Crouch ran unopposed in the Montana House of Representatives District 45 Democratic primary.[3][4]

2010

See also: Montana House of Representatives elections, 2010

Crouch had no opposition in the primary. He was defeated by incumbent Cary Smith (R) in the November 2 general election.

Montana House of Representatives, District 55 General Election (2010)
Candidates Votes
Green check mark transparent.png Cary Smith (R) 2,852
Ken Crouch (D) 1,288
